Had the same issue at a formal 40th just before Christmas. I was informed by She Who Must Be Obeyed that: 1) I am going in a suit. 2) I am leaving my bag and Bat belt at home. At that point I balked, that's like being asked to show up wearing my birthday suit and a smile. So I cheated. Leatherman PS4 and Victorinox Midnight Manager on a dangler chain right front pocket. Keys, AAA torch and peanut lighter left front pocket. During the evening, everything except the lighter got used.

Not exactly tuxedo, but I'm EDCing a lot in my business sport coat quite inconspicuously. Including the cut off steel flask with USB self solar charging power bank, AC adapter, USB cable, disposable rain poncho, pepper spray, shocker, water filter, lighter, 256Gb total of various type and format data storage, set of credit, id, business, RFID/NFC access cards, 2 sterile scalpel blades, some pills, safety pins, sewing needles with plenty of #8 nylon thread, and a microfiber cloth. (even more stuff is on my belt, on the neck, and in the pants pockets). The secret is in the organizing this stuff in flat bundles distributing the bulk evenly in the pockets.

At my brother's wedding:
Pen/paper - constantly in use. I was part of the wedding party and had all the minor details (like who I was partnered with, schedule, etc.) jotted down in mini composition book. Also, a good opportunity to show off your nicer pens. What's the point of being a gear junkie if you can't show off on occasion.
LM Micra - no use. But, a tuxedo is a perfect place to carry that classic pen or Barlow knife.
Fenix E05 - Critical to have this. Escorting my kids to the bathroom (many times), taking motor mouth (son) outside for a cool down (many times), hauling rear down a dark, unlit driveway, in the rain, to get to the shuttle (large school bus), illuminating the inside of the shuttle
Hanky - It was a warm day. And, of course, the kids.
Earplugs - I did mentions my kids, right!?!
What I should have had:
Moleskin and pocket sewing kit - Thankfully the ladies were nicely prepared for the expected wardrobe problems.
Flask - Not for whiskey, but for water. It was a warm day.
